开云体育Try tightening up the ring contact on the 3.5mm jack. ?If you reach in with a very small barrow blade screwdriver you can bend that contact out to place more tension in the plug for a more reliable contact.That fixed my intermittent on the QMX. ?On the QMX+ I installed Kobiconn jacks (Mouser) on the rear panel. I used the TRRS jack for even more retention of the plugs. Dave WI6R On Mar 25, 2025, at 08:26, Petrov Sergey via groups.io <irtish71@...> wrote:
